Tori Spelling, Dean McDermott Owe $400K Decade-Old Loan Amid Divorce
Tori Spelling and her estranged husband Dean McDermott are embroiled in a long-standing legal battle over a $400,000 loan from City National Bank taken out in 2012, which they have failed to repay. Despite a default judgment issued in 2017 ordering them to pay over $220,000, neither has made any payments, and accumulated interest has nearly doubled the amount owed to approximately $395,730. City National Bank recently filed court documents seeking to renew the judgment to continue collection efforts, with the latest filing naming only Spelling as a defendant. The couple separated in June 2023 after 17 years of marriage and share five children. Spelling filed for divorce in March 2024, requesting spousal support, legal fees, and custody arrangements, while McDermott has contested some separation details. The financial strain is compounded by reported tax liens and personal hardships, including Spelling and her children living in a motel and an RV amid their separation.
